    I finally got to eat here! I came with some co-workers yesterday during lunch and we had a good time. First off, the lunch price is at $21.99, and this includes two trips to the buffet although they allow a third trip in which they don't state because lots of people tend to go over what they want and don't finish. The restaurant is clean, and the owner's make sure they're wiping the buffet bar often. It looks as if the husband does the cooking while the wife goes around checking on tables and guests, etc. I would also like to thank Jenny, one of the employees, for being so nice and treating us like family. She gave us knowledge about the place and its history, etc. They have most of everything you'd typically want in a Mongolian buffet bar except I wish they had lamb as a lunch item as opposed to just dinner. The food is cooked fresh and hot! I love that they have additional condiments such as sesame oil, teriyaki sauce, and more to add into your bowl. I do think they should also include fried rice, soup, and other hot items as part of the experience to draw-in more customers. The old Mongolian BBQ spot in Santa Clara used to have all this and they were so popular and loved. Overall, we thoroughly enjoyed this place and will definitely come back again for lunch. It's so delicious and can't wait to come back.

    Beware: they charge you if you want to take leftovers home. Definitely not coming back here again. Came here on a whim on the way home from the airport, should've just gone straight home. Buffet options are very limited. Ingredients are either unwashed (skip the mushrooms, they had dirt still on them) or not washed well. The sauce options used for both before and after cooking are all bland and tasted stale. Service was disappointing. The cook and servers all stared us down while we were grabbing our food. Felt like they were watching us to see how much food we put into our bowls (because god forbid paying customers take the amount of food they want... at a buffet). Cherry on top? The extra charge for the to-go box. It's not even the amount, it's the principle of the matter. For the first time in my life, I'm being charged for a to-go box to take home LEFTOVERS. The lady (same one who rang us up) seemed to not understand that yes, people take leftovers home. When I asked for a box, she was very confused. We had over half of the bowl left too. I even pointed to the bowl to show her and she still didn't seem to understand. Do they eat their customers' leftovers, is that why she was confused? I genuinely do not understand her reaction to such a standard request at a restaurant. The place was decently clean. Nothing to write home about. Editing to add: they also calculate tip based on the total, not subtotal on their POS system. Be sure to double check the tip so you're not paying tip on the sales tax. So frustrating when restaurants do this. Such a shady and dishonest way to do business.

    make your own Mongolian bbq noodle bowl. You get 4 bowls, 2 trips for 25$ which is a pretty good deal, but it's only for dine in. Free ice cream and rice whenever you please and there's no time limit for you to finish your food. You can only take the first round of food togo and the second round if you stay to eat you can't take it togo. Weird concept, but makes sense to encourage customers to dine in. There's free refills on only fountain drinks, but make sure to ask for the fountain coke instead of just saying coke because last time they gave us a canned coke and we had no idea they had fountain drinks with free refills. The staff's friendly, but can barely speak english, they have a young boy working the cashier who is kind and helps to translate. Overall bee here a couple times, food is good if you're looking for a place to eat with a big serving and ambiance is okay, spacious, but a little loud. 8.5/10
